There is no 'audioSource' attached to the game object error
I type these at the top of one javascript :
public var mHitClip : AudioClip; @script RequireComponent(AudioSource)
And then in update(), I write: audio.PlayOneShot(mHitClip);
Then I drag an audio file to match the public variable. when runing, there is a error: There is no 'AudioSource' attached to the game object, but a script is trying to access it.
How to deal with this problem? Thank you for taking time reading this.
Answer by Jason B · Jun 23, 2011 at 02:33 PM
The error tells you exactly what the problem is and how to fix it. You have no Audio Source attached to the game object that this script is running on.
